Index Data’s Nassib Nassar is presenting a project briefing at the CNI 2020 Fall Member meeting on Metadb, an open source, data analytics infrastructure.  Metadb fills a need for modern data management features in analytics such as real-time data streaming, data integration, and data versioning.  The project brings these capabilities to the Library Data Platform […]
